Transaction 3c9af131c55ac41f70d205816569dec64d5a214cde018f5b379c8e3bdf3cb05d
1 Input
1 Output
-
3c9af131c55ac41f70d205816569dec64d5a214cde018f5b379c8e3bdf3cb05d:0
- value
- 12998460
- script pubkey
- OP_0 OP_PUSHBYTES_20 c147ccb763886aa5799d59972af99a28bf3340fd
- address
- bc1qc9ruedmr3p4227vatxtj47v69zlnxs8ayf8g49